Job Summary:
Coordinate machine and attachment activity. Ensure rental fleet machines and attachments are capable of a safe and successful rental.
Responsibilities:
 Responsible for coordinating and processing both inbound and outbound movement of machines and attachments on a daily basis  Responsible for completion of initial check-in of machines and attachments to include
  • o Documentation of machine hours and fuel level o Verification unit's manual is present o Take pictures of each unit
  • noting obvious damage o Notify Service Department and Equipment Manager immediately of any damage identified on a unit o Advise Equipment Manager of unit arrival
  • provide check-in information o Ensure unit is clean, safe and rental ready o Park unit in appropriate area of the yard  Responsible for completion of check-out process to include
  • o Verification of equipment/serial number against shipper o Take pictures of each unit o Confirm manual is present o Confirm appropriate attachment(s) are included o Assist/load for shipment  Utilize tablet for both check-in and check-out processes  Locate and store machines and attachments in a neat and organized manner  Responsible for identifying status of each unit  Exercise each unit on the yard periodically  Perform consignment inspections  Responsible to ensure yard and tracking devices are present and working on each unit (RFID)  Provide information when requested  Other tasks as requested by management
Education/Experience/Skills:
 High School Diploma or G.E.D. equivalent  Basic computer skills  Ability to operate a wide range of equipment  Able to work with minimal supervision  Skilled at prioritizing  Basic technical aptitude  Good verbal and written communication skills  Ability to work under pressure and to meet deadlines  Able to work overtime on a regular basis  Able to climb on and off equipment and to walk all day
